
Stockton Kings Fall to Santa Cruz Warriors 109-99
Published on March 3, 2022 under NBA G League (G League)
Stockton Kings News Release
Stockton, CA - The Stockton Kings (10-11), of the NBA G League, were defeated by the Santa Cruz Warriors (9-12), 109-99 at Stockton Arena on Wednesday night.
The first half went back and forth with both teams trading buckets with the biggest lead belonging to Stockton with 18-11. Kings guard Matt Coleman III led the team in scoring at the half with thirteen points, added two rebounds and four assists. Kings forward Sheldon Mac provided a spark off the bench in the first half with twelve points, two rebounds, two assists and two steals. Warriors forward Jerome Robinson led the half with sixteen points on 4-6 shooting, added four rebounds and two assists. Stockton entered the break trailing 62-61 while shooting .523 percent, .500 percent from three-point land and .833 percent from the free throw line.
The second half started out much like the first with the two teams going back and forth. Santa Cruz took the lead by seven at the end of the third shooting more efficiently, .526 percent compared to .435 percent in the first half. In addition, Santa Cruz finished shooting .476 percent from the field, .243 percent from three and shot .917 percent from the free throw line for the entire game. Warriors forward Jerome Robinson led the game in scoring 28 points, added six rebounds, four assists and two steals.
Kings guard Quinn Cook and forward Mac led the team in scoring 15 points apiece. Kings guard Coleman finished with 13 points and four rebounds. Kings forward Christian Terrell and center Neemias Queta each added 14 points. As a team, the Kings shot .402 percent from the field, .324 percent from three and .923 percent from the free throw line.
